Anne Frank, 14, spoke of her desire to be a typical teenager who could go outside and "look at the world" after being locked within her father's office building for a year and a half. The following can be understood from the given passage:
1. The mood of the passage is inspiring since Anne Frank speaks about her loneliness and eagerness to see the world in beautiful words.
2. Anne compare the Annex to a prison as the deepest regions of the underworld.
3. Anne symbolizes herself as the bird whose wings have been ripped off who keeps hurling itself against the bars of its dark cage and who is crying and wants to be free to get fresh air and laughter.
4. because it’s written from the perspective of a normal adolescent living under the most abnormal circumstances, it humanized war and genocide, Anne Frank's diary has moved so many people.
To conclude, Frank’s diary became one of the most famous narratives of the Holocaust. It's heartening that Frank's story continues to interest new generations as the events that formed her brief existence fade away.
